Fairmont Kea Lani is a 22-acre luxury hotel that sits on Wailea’s Polo Beach’s golden sands. Its name, Kea Lani, is Hawaiian for “white heaven,” which is true of the interior. However, the surrounding areas are more golden than white, but the beauty is just as enchanting. Besides, even though the hotel is secluded, recreational spots are within a mile from the property.

The resort opened up to the public in 1991. Architect Jose Luis Ezquerra is the man to thank for the slightly non-Hawaiian interior decor. This decor style came about because of his expertise lying major with Middle Eastern and Mediterranean designs.

Norfolk pines line the entrance, and patterned tiles adorn the lobby floor, with vaulted arches and geometric fountained pools. This sort of architecture exudes a calm and refined elegance. The most outstanding thing about the suites is the size, each starting at 860 square feet. There are 450 suites and 1 to 3 bedroom villas in this hotel — all massive in size. Additionally, the warm color palette, wooden furniture, and carpeting give the space sophistication.

Scattered around the living room and bedroom areas are sleeper sofas, small kitchens, a large, comfy bed, coffeemakers, and two flat-screen TVs. Wi-Fi access is also available for a small fee, which also covers the use of other hotel amenities.

Some other suites have a larger kitchen and a massive balcony with an outdoor dining set. Furthermore, villas are more furnished with two or three bedrooms, a private outdoor plunge pool, barbecue grills, and full-in-unit washer-dryers. Besides, because of the recent renovation that the hotel underwent, stunning Pacific Ocean views overshadow the minimalist decor.

Moreover, the luxe marble bathrooms in each suite and luxury villa contain walk-in showers, soaking tubs, dual marble sinks, bathrobes, and Le Labo toiletries.

This luxury hotel has several upscale restaurants you can dine in. The Kea Lani Restaurant, a poolside dining area, offers breakfast in a buffet style. Besides, Hawaiian fusion restaurant K? serves regional Hawaiian cuisine for lunch and dinner every day.

Nick’s Fishmarket serves freshly caught seafood, along with a collection of wines — 2,000 bottles exactly. Both the K? and Nick’s Fishmarket restaurants have excellent views of the ocean and the beach. Also, the Ama Bar and Grill has poolside seating for dining on casual Hawaiian dishes.

If you’re more of a light snacker, Makana Market offers coffee, pastries, sandwiches, salads, and pizza. Besides, the Luana Lounge will have you dining in a beautifully decorated space, with live entertainment and rum as bonuses. There’s also the in-room dining option if you prefer having your meals in the comfort of your room.
